The only decent copy (nitrate) of this film survived in the Finnish Film Archives possession and was used for the new restored version (2004) done by Bundesarchiv-Filmarchiv (Berlin) with the support of Waldemar Bonsels-Stiftung.
Filmed in May 1924, completed in 1925, released in 1926.
A 40 minute cut of the British version of Maya is retained in a private archive in Scotland on original 35mm nitrate stock. The archive had also reprinted sections of the film to super 8mm format in 1987 having claimed UK rights and then a full reprint in 2000 for preservation. The 35mm original is the only other known copy of Maya and is scheduled for a 4K transfer possibly in 2015.
